![]() |
ERIS CORE
|
const int16_t PROGMEM wt_49[] = {0, 464, 918, 1354, 1762, 2136, 2467, 2751, 2986, 3168, 3298, 3379, 3414, 3407, 3366, 3297, 3212, 3117, 3024, 2943, 2881, 2850, 2857, 2907, 3007, 3161, 3369, 3633, 3952, 4320, 4734, 5187, 5670, 6176, 6695, 7216, 7731, 8230, 8703, 9141, 9539, 9892, 10193, 10442, 10636, 10779, 10873, 10922, 10933, 10913, 10870, 10812, 10750, 10692, 10649, 10628, 10637, 10682, 10767, 10897, 11074, 11296, 11559, 11863, 12199, 12560, 12939, 13323, 13702, 14066, 14403, 14700, 14948, 15135, 15255, 15297, 15257, 15132, 14917, 14613, 14223, 13750, 13199, 12578, 11894, 11160, 10384, 9578, 8752, 7919, 7091, 6273, 5479, 4714, 3986, 3296, 2651, 2048, 1490, 972, 489, 37, -390, -801, -1205, -1608, -2022, -2451, -2907, -3397, -3923, -4494, -5111, -5775, -6488, -7246, -8049, -8888, -9760, -10658, -11569, -12488, -13402, -14304, -15181, -16023, -16823, -17571, -18259, -18881, -19431, -19906, -20303, -20623, -20864, -21030, -21124, -21150, -21112, -21018, -20873, -20685, -20461, -20206, -19928, -19632, -19323, -19005, -18683, -18357, -18028, -17696, -17361, -17022, -16673, -16312, -15934, -15535, -15112, -14655, -14166, -13634, -13061, -12438, -11768, -11046, -10273, -9450, -8576, -7656, -6692, -5690, -4653, -3589, -2503, -1401, -294, 816, 1920, 3012, 4085, 5135, 6157, 7148, 8102, 9021, 9902, 10747, 11555, 12328, 13071, 13785, 14475, 15146, 15803, 16450, 17092, 17734, 18380, 19034, 19698, 20376, 21069, 21777, 22500, 23237, 23984, 24737, 25496, 26251, 26996, 27730, 28439, 29120, 29763, 30362, 30909, 31397, 31820, 32170, 32444, 32636, 32745, 32767, 32704, 32553, 32318, 32000, 31604, 31134, 30597, 29998, 29347, 28649, 27912, 27147, 26360, 25558, 24751, 23943, 23142, 22352, 21577, 20820, 20083, 19366, 18670, 17990, 17327, 16672, 16025, 15379, 14727, 14063, 13381, 12676, 11940, 11169, 10358, 9500, 8598, 7647, 6646, 5598, 4505, 3370, 2199, 998, -225, -1462, -2704, -3940, -5163, -6361, -7526, -8646, -9713, -10722, -11665, -12537, -13335, -14056, -14700, -15270, -15767, -16196, -16566, -16880, -17150, -17383, -17590, -17783, -17969, -18160, -18366, -18594, -18853, -19150, -19489, -19872, -20301, -20779, -21299, -21860, -22456, -23081, -23725, -24380, -25035, -25677, -26298, -26886, -27428, -27917, -28341, -28692, -28965, -29153, -29250, -29258, -29175, -29000, -28740, -28397, -27977, -27486, -26935, -26332, -25686, -25006, -24302, -23583, -22858, -22135, -21419, -20719, -20037, -19377, -18739, -18126, -17534, -16965, -16411, -15870, -15337, -14806, -14272, -13727, -13167, -12586, -11978, -11339, -10665, -9954, -9205, -8415, -7587, -6721, -5818, -4884, -3922, -2937, -1931, -913, 113, 1144, 2174, 3197, 4210, 5210, 6194, 7160, 8107, 9036, 9943, 10834, 11707, 12564, 13407, 14238, 15058, 15869, 16672, 17467, 18254, 19031, 19797, 20549, 21285, 22000, 22688, 23344, 23963, 24538, 25064, 25533, 25940, 26281, 26547, 26739, 26852, 26885, 26837, 26708, 26501, 26221, 25872, 25458, 24990, 24472, 23916, 23329, 22722, 22105, 21485, 20873, 20275, 19701, 19154, 18639, 18162, 17723, 17321, 16957, 16626, 16323, 16045, 15783, 15530, 15276, 15015, 14735, 14427, 14083, 13695, 13255, 12756, 12193, 11564, 10865, 10094, 9256, 8353, 7385, 6364, 5295, 4187, 3048, 1893, 730, -427, -1568, -2679, -3748, -4766, -5721, -6603, -7406, -8121, -8743, -9268, -9693, -10017, -10242, -10369, -10399, -10342, -10200, -9979, -9692, -9342, -8943, -8502, -8028, -7533, -7025, -6515, -6011, -5524, -5058, -4623, -4224, -3867, -3555, -3293, -3083, -2926, -2821, -2767, -2765, -2807, -2894, -3018, -3175, -3358, -3560, -3775, -3994, -4208, -4411, -4595, -4752, -4874, -4955, -4990, -4972, -4899, -4766, -4571, -4315, -3999, -3624, -3193, -2714, -2190, -1631, -1045, -442, 169, 774, 1362, 1922, 2441, 2909, 3312, 3643, 3892, 4052, 4114, 4077, 3934, 3689, 3340, 2891, 2348, 1718, 1009, 230, -603, -1480, -2388, -3310, -4235, -5145, -6027, -6869, -7658, -8384, -9036, -9608, -10094, -10492, -10798, -11016, -11145, -11194, -11168, -11075, -10925, -10729, -10500, -10248, -9985, -9725, -9478, -9255, -9065, -8917, -8816, -8768, -8775, -8837, -8954, -9121, -9336, -9588, -9873, -10179, -10497, -10813, -11118, -11399, -11644, -11845, -11988, -12067, -12072, -11998, -11840, -11594, -11260, -10837, -10329, -9737, -9068, -8330, -7527, -6670, -5766, -4826, -3858, -2874, -1881, -887, 100, 1071, 2023, 2948, 3845, 4709, 5539, 6334, 7095, 7819, 8511, 9171, 9800, 10399, 10971, 11517, 12036, 12531, 12998, 13440, 13852, 14233, 14578, 14886, 15154, 15374, 15546, 15663, 15724, 15725, 15663, 15535, 15343, 15087, 14767, 14387, 13951, 13463, 12931, 12360, 11759, 11137, 10503, 9864, 9233, 8615, 8021, 7457, 6928, 6441, 5998, 5601, 5252, 4946, 4682, 4455, 4255, 4078, 3913, 3748, 3576, 3382, 3155, 2886, 2562, 2175, 1716, 1178, 557, -149, -943, -1822, -2783, -3819, -4921, -6082, -7287, -8523, -9775, -11029, -12267, -13474, -14633, -15731, -16752, -17684, -18518, -19241, -19851, -20343, -20714, -20966, -21105, -21136, -21066, -20908, -20675, -20379, -20035, -19663, -19274, -18888, -18518, -18179, -17885, -17647, -17476, -17376, -17355, -17415, -17556, -17774, -18067, -18427, -18843, -19307, -19804, -20324, -20853, -21376, -21878, -22349, -22773, -23143, -23447, -23677, -23830, -23901, -23890, -23800, -23632, -23394, -23094, -22741, -22348, -21926, -21490, -21052, -20628, -20231, -19874, -19570, -19330, -19163, -19075, -19074, -19162, -19339, -19605, -19956, -20388, -20891, -21458, -22078, -22738, -23425, -24127, -24831, -25521, -26188, -26819, -27400, -27925, -28386, -28775, -29089, -29325, -29482, -29564, -29572, -29513, -29392, -29218, -28999, -28747, -28471, -28181, -27889, -27605, -27339, -27098, -26892, -26728, -26608, -26538, -26521, -26554, -26638, -26770, -26944, -27157, -27400, -27665, -27944, -28226, -28502, -28762, -28995, -29192, -29344, -29442, -29480, -29447, -29342, -29157, -28894, -28546, -28116, -27605, -27015, -26351, -25617, -24821, -23968, -23068, -22127, -21158, -20167, -19165, -18160, -17165, -16186, -15231, -14311, -13429, -12593, -11808, -11077, -10405, -9790, -9236, -8740, -8302, -7916, -7581, -7290, -7039, -6820, -6629, -6457, -6294, -6138, -5978, -5810, -5625, -5419, -5187, -4924, -4631, -4303, -3941, -3546, -3121, -2669, -2194, -1703, -1204, -704, -210, 266, 718, 1134, 1507, 1827, 2087, 2278, 2396, 2436, 2395, 2270, 2064, 1775, 1411, 974, 475, -81, -684, -1321, -1982, -2653, -3322, -3976, -4604, -5193, -5731, -6210, -6624, -6964, -7226, -7409, -7513, -7539, -7493, -7381, -7210, -6994, -6739, -6463, -6177, -5896, -5635, -5408, -5227, -5106, -5056, -5084, -5202, -5411, -5717, -6117, -6612, -7195, -7862, -8601, -9400, -10249, -11132, -12031, -12932, -13819, -14674, -15481, -16224, -16891, -17470, -17949, -18320, -18579, -18720, -18746, -18657, -18457, -18154, -17754, -17272, -16716, -16102, -15441, -14752, -14045, -13339, -12643, -11974, -11339, -10750, -10214, -9736, -9320, -8968, -8679, -8449, -8274, -8149, -8065, -8013, -7984, -7966, -7949, -7923, -7877, -7803, -7690, -7533, -7324, -7061, -6739, -6358, -5920, -5425, -4879, -4287, -3654, -2991, -2303, -1601, -895, -193, 495, 1159, 1793, 2388, 2936, 3434, 3875, 4260, 4582, 4846, 5047, 5189, 5276, 5309, 5295, 5235, 5136, 5004, 4842, 4658, 4455, 4238, 4012, 3780, 3547, 3314, 3084, 2859, 2639, 2427, 2221, 2023, 1832, 1646, 1467, 1293, 1123, 957, 794, 632, 472, 314, 157, 0, -157, -314, -472, -632, -794, -957, -1123, -1293, -1468, -1647, -1832, -2023, -2221, -2427, -2640, -2858, -3084, -3314, -3546, -3780, -4012, -4237, -4454, -4658, -4842, -5004, -5136, -5234, -5294, -5310, -5276, -5190, -5047, -4845, -4582, -4259, -3876, -3434, -2936, -2388, -1793, -1159, -495, 193, 894, 1601, 2303, 2991, 3654, 4286, 4879, 5425, 5920, 6358, 6739, 7061, 7324, 7533, 7690, 7803, 7878, 7924, 7950, 7966, 7984, 8013, 8065, 8149, 8274, 8449, 8678, 8968, 9320, 9735, 10214, 10750, 11340, 11974, 12645, 13339, 14046, 14751, 15442, 16101, 16716, 17272, 17755, 18154, 18457, 18657, 18746, 18721, 18578, 18320, 17949, 17470, 16891, 16225, 15480, 14674, 13819, 12933, 12031, 11131, 10250, 9400, 8600, 7862, 7196, 6612, 6117, 5716, 5411, 5201, 5085, 5055, 5105, 5227, 5407, 5636, 5897, 6177, 6462, 6739, 6993, 7210, 7381, 7493, 7539, 7513, 7409, 7226, 6963, 6624, 6211, 5730, 5192, 4604, 3977, 3323, 2653, 1982, 1322, 684, 82, -474, -975, -1411, -1775, -2063, -2270, -2394, -2436, -2395, -2277, -2086, -1827, -1506, -1135, -718, -267, 211, 703, 1205, 1704, 2194, 2669, 3121, 3546, 3941, 4302, 4630, 4925, 5186, 5418, 5625, 5810, 5978, 6138, 6295, 6456, 6629, 6821, 7038, 7291, 7580, 7916, 8301, 8740, 9236, 9791, 10405, 11077, 11808, 12593, 13429, 14310, 15232, 16185, 17166, 18161, 19165, 20166, 21157, 22127, 23068, 23968, 24821, 25617, 26350, 27015, 27605, 28116, 28546, 28893, 29158, 29342, 29448, 29479, 29443, 29344, 29192, 28995, 28761, 28501, 28225, 27942, 27665, 27400, 27157, 26945, 26770, 26638, 26553, 26520, 26539, 26608, 26727, 26893, 27098, 27339, 27605, 27889, 28181, 28471, 28747, 28999, 29218, 29391, 29512, 29572, 29564, 29482, 29324, 29088, 28776, 28385, 27925, 27400, 26819, 26189, 25522, 24830, 24127, 23425, 22737, 22078, 21458, 20892, 20388, 19957, 19605, 19340, 19162, 19073, 19077, 19163, 19330, 19571, 19875, 20231, 20627, 21052, 21490, 21926, 22348, 22741, 23094, 23394, 23633, 23800, 23890, 23901, 23829, 23677, 23446, 23142, 22773, 22348, 21879, 21376, 20853, 20324, 19805, 19306, 18843, 18425, 18067, 17775, 17556, 17415, 17356, 17376, 17475, 17647, 17885, 18179, 18518, 18888, 19274, 19663, 20036, 20379, 20674, 20907, 21066, 21135, 21104, 20967, 20714, 20342, 19851, 19242, 18517, 17685, 16752, 15731, 14634, 13474, 12267, 11029, 9775, 8522, 7286, 6081, 4921, 3819, 2783, 1823, 943, 149, -558, -1178, -1716, -2175, -2562, -2886, -3155, -3382, -3577, -3749, -3913, -4079, -4255, -4454, -4682, -4947, -5251, -5601, -5998, -6441, -6928, -7456, -8020, -8616, -9232, -9865, -10502, -11138, -11759, -12360, -12930, -13463, -13952, -14388, -14768, -15087, -15344, -15535, -15662, -15725, -15725, -15663, -15546, -15373, -15153, -14886, -14578, -14232, -13851, -13441, -12999, -12532, -12038, -11517, -10971, -10400, -9800, -9171, -8511, -7820, -7094, -6335, -5539, -4708, -3844, -2949, -2023, -1071, -99, 887, 1880, 2874, 3859, 4826, 5766, 6669, 7527, 8329, 9068, 9738, 10328, 10838, 11260, 11594, 11841, 11998, 12073, 12068, 11988, 11845, 11645, 11399, 11117, 10813, 10495, 10179, 9874, 9590, 9336, 9122, 8953, 8838, 8774, 8769, 8816, 8917, 9065, 9255, 9478, 9725, 9986, 10248, 10500, 10730, 10925, 11076, 11168, 11195, 11145, 11016, 10798, 10491, 10094, 9608, 9036, 8383, 7658, 6869, 6027, 5145, 4234, 3311, 2389, 1480, 603, -230, -1009, -1718, -2348, -2892, -3341, -3689, -3935, -4077, -4115, -4051, -3892, -3644, -3312, -2908, -2441, -1922, -1362, -773, -168, 441, 1045, 1631, 2190, 2713, 3193, 3624, 3999, 4315, 4571, 4766, 4898, 4972, 4990, 4956, 4875, 4752, 4595, 4411, 4209, 3994, 3775, 3562, 3358, 3176, 3018, 2893, 2807, 2765, 2767, 2820, 2926, 3083, 3293, 3555, 3866, 4224, 4623, 5058, 5523, 6011, 6515, 7025, 7533, 8028, 8500, 8942, 9342, 9692, 9979, 10199, 10342, 10400, 10369, 10242, 10017, 9693, 9268, 8743, 8121, 7406, 6604, 5721, 4766, 3749, 2678, 1568, 428, -730, -1893, -3048, -4186, -5295, -6365, -7386, -8352, -9257, -10095, -10864, -11563, -12194, -12756, -13255, -13695, -14084, -14427, -14734, -15016, -15277, -15530, -15783, -16045, -16324, -16626, -16956, -17321, -17723, -18162, -18640, -19153, -19700, -20276, -20873, -21485, -22104, -22722, -23329, -23916, -24472, -24989, -25458, -25872, -26221, -26501, -26708, -26836, -26885, -26852, -26740, -26547, -26280, -25940, -25532, -25063, -24539, -23963, -23344, -22688, -21999, -21286, -20549, -19797, -19031, -18253, -17467, -16672, -15869, -15059, -14238, -13407, -12564, -11707, -10835, -9944, -9035, -8108, -7160, -6194, -5210, -4211, -3196, -2173, -1145, -114, 913, 1931, 2937, 3923, 4884, 5819, 6720, 7586, 8416, 9204, 9954, 10665, 11339, 11977, 12586, 13167, 13727, 14271, 14807, 15337, 15871, 16411, 16965, 17535, 18126, 18739, 19377, 20038, 20720, 21420, 22135, 22858, 23582, 24302, 25006, 25685, 26332, 26936, 27487, 27976, 28396, 28740, 29001, 29174, 29258, 29251, 29152, 28964, 28692, 28341, 27917, 27428, 26885, 26298, 25678, 25034, 24381, 23726, 23082, 22457, 21861, 21298, 20778, 20302, 19871, 19487, 19149, 18853, 18595, 18365, 18160, 17970, 17782, 17591, 17384, 17150, 16881, 16566, 16197, 15767, 15270, 14700, 14056, 13335, 12537, 11665, 10722, 9713, 8645, 7526, 6361, 5164, 3941, 2704, 1462, 225, -998, -2199, -3370, -4504, -5598, -6646, -7647, -8598, -9501, -10357, -11170, -11941, -12677, -13381, -14064, -14727, -15378, -16025, -16673, -17326, -17990, -18670, -19367, -20084, -20820, -21577, -22352, -23142, -23944, -24752, -25559, -26360, -27147, -27914, -28650, -29347, -30000, -30598, -31134, -31603, -31999, -32318, -32553, -32704, -32768, -32745, -32636, -32444, -32170, -31820, -31397, -30909, -30363, -29764, -29120, -28439, -27729, -26997, -26250, -25495, -24737, -23983, -23236, -22500, -21777, -21069, -20376, -19698, -19033, -18380, -17734, -17091, -16449, -15803, -15146, -14476, -13784, -13070, -12328, -11554, -10746, -9901, -9020, -8102, -7147, -6158, -5134, -4085, -3011, -1920, -816, 293, 1402, 2502, 3588, 4653, 5689, 6692, 7655, 8577, 9449, 10273, 11046, 11768, 12439, 13060, 13634, 14165, 14656, 15111, 15536, 15934, 16311, 16673, 17022, 17362, 17697, 18027, 18357, 18684, 19006, 19324, 19632, 19928, 20206, 20460, 20686, 20872, 21018, 21111, 21150, 21124, 21030, 20865, 20623, 20303, 19906, 19431, 18881, 18259, 17570, 16823, 16023, 15181, 14304, 13403, 12487, 11569, 10657, 9761, 8889, 8048, 7246, 6487, 5775, 5110, 4493, 3923, 3397, 2907, 2451, 2021, 1608, 1205, 802, 391, -37, -489, -971, -1489, -2049, -2651, -3297, -3985, -4715, -5480, -6273, -7090, -7920, -8752, -9577, -10384, -11160, -11895, -12577, -13199, -13750, -14223, -14613, -14917, -15131, -15257, -15297, -15255, -15136, -14948, -14701, -14403, -14067, -13702, -13322, -12938, -12560, -12199, -11862, -11560, -11296, -11074, -10898, -10767, -10682, -10637, -10628, -10650, -10693, -10749, -10812, -10870, -10913, -10933, -10923, -10874, -10780, -10636, -10440, -10193, -9891, -9539, -9141, -8703, -8229, -7731, -7217, -6694, -6175, -5670, -5186, -4734, -4320, -3952, -3633, -3369, -3160, -3007, -2906, -2856, -2851, -2882, -2942, -3024, -3117, -3211, -3298, -3366, -3406, -3414, -3379, -3299, -3167, -2985, -2752, -2467, -2136, -1763, -1354, -919, -464} |
Definition at line 77 of file eris_waveshapes.cpp.